2024年5月30日发(作者:)
excel筛选文字的函数
Excel是一款非常常用的电子表格软件,它的功能非
常强大。在Excel中,我们可以通过使用各种函数来完成
各种操作。其中,筛选文字的函数是非常常用的一个。本
文将为大家详细介绍Excel中的筛选文字的函数,希望对
大家有所帮助。
1. 筛选包含特定字符的单元格
在Excel中,我们可以使用COUNTIF函数来筛选包含
特定字符的单元格。其语法如下:
COUNTIF( range, criteria )
其中,range表示需要进行筛选的范围,criteria表
示所需要筛选的字符串。例如,要筛选包含“abc”的单元
格,可以使用如下公式:
=COUNTIF(A1:A10,"*abc*")
这个公式的意思是,在A1到A10这个范围内筛选出包
含“abc”的单元格。其中,*表示通配符,代表任意字
符。
2. 筛选不包含特定字符的单元格
如果我们需要筛选不包含特定字符的单元格,我们可
以使用COUNTIFS函数。其语法如下:
COUNTIFS( criteria_range1, criteria1,
[criteria_range2, criteria2], ... )
其中,criteria_range1代表需要筛选的范围,
criteria1表示需要筛选的字符串。例如,要筛选不包含
“abc”的单元格,可以使用如下公式:
=COUNTIFS(A1:A10,"<>*abc*")
这个公式的意思是,在A1到A10这个范围内筛选出不
包含“abc”的单元格。其中,<>表示不等于。
3. 筛选以特定字符开头的单元格
如果我们需要筛选以特定字符开头的单元格,我们可
以使用LEFT函数。其语法如下:
LEFT( string, [length] )
其中,string表示需要进行筛选的字符串,length表
示所需要筛选的字符长度。例如,要筛选以“abc”开头的
单元格,可以使用如下公式:
=IF(LEFT(A1,3)="abc",A1,"")
这个公式的意思是,将A1这个单元格的前三个字符与
“abc”进行比较,如果相同就输出A1的值,否则输空。
4. 筛选以特定字符结尾的单元格
如果我们需要筛选以特定字符结尾的单元格,我们可
以使用RIGHT函数。其语法如下:
RIGHT( string, [length] )
其中,string表示需要进行筛选的字符串,length表
示所需要筛选的字符长度。例如,要筛选以“abc”结尾的
单元格,可以使用如下公式:
=IF(RIGHT(A1,3)="abc",A1,"")
这个公式的意思是,将A1这个单元格的最后三个字符
与“abc”进行比较,如果相同就输出A1的值,否则输
空。
5. 筛选包含特定字符且字符长度大于等于特定数值的
单元格
如果我们需要筛选包含特定字符且字符长度大于等于
特定数值的单元格,我们可以使用LEN和FIND函数。其语
法如下:
LEN( text ) 查找字符串的长度
FIND( find_text, within_text, [start_num] ) 查
找一个字符串在另一个字符串中的位置
例如,要筛选包含“abc”且长度大于等于5的单元
格,可以使用如下公式:
=IF(AND(ISNUMBER(FIND("abc",A1)),LEN(A1)>=5),A1
,"")
这个公式的意思是,首先查找A1中是否包含
“abc”,如果包含再判断A1的长度是否大于等于5,如果
满足条件就输出A1的值,否则输空。
总结
Excel中的筛选文字的函数非常实用,可以帮助我们
快速地筛选出我们所需要的数据。我们可以通过使用
COUNTIF、COUNTIFS、LEFT、RIGHT、LEN和FIND函数等来
实现各种不同的筛选操作。当然,需要注意的是,在使用
这些函数时,应尽量保证公式的简洁性和可读性,以避免
出现混乱的情况。
发布者:admin,转转请注明出处:http://www.yc00.com/news/1717023852a2732926.html
评论列表(0条)